movement (noun)

/ˈmuːvmənt   / noun
 
CHANGING POSITION
1 [countable, uncountable]
an act of moving
hareket
 The dancer's movements were smooth and controlled.
 The seat belt doesn't allow much freedom of movement.
 I could see some movement in the trees.
 2 [countable, uncountable]
an act of moving or being moved from one place to another
hareket, yer değiştirme
 the slow movement of the clouds across the sky
GROUP OF PEOPLE
3 [countable]
a group of people who have the same aims or ideas
akım, hareket
 I support the peace movement.
SB'S ACTIVITIES
4 (movements)
[plural]
sb's actions or plans during a period of time
hareketler, faaliyet
 Detectives have been watching the man's movements for several weeks.
CHANGE OF IDEAS/BEHAVIOUR
5 [countable, usually singular]
a movement (away from/towards sth)
a general change in the way people think or behave
eğilim, akım
 There's been a movement away from the materialism of the 1980s.
MUSIC
6 [countable]
one of the main parts of a long piece of music
 (müzik eseri) bölüm
 a symphony in four movements
